Transaction 64c651248a7a0410f1ff52f1a784fa1a06a03d83faa2c669d63ae2c4bb851b59

1 Input
2 Outputs
  • 64c651248a7a0410f1ff52f1a784fa1a06a03d83faa2c669d63ae2c4bb851b59:0
  • value  198901667
    address  1A3taNJkETKbkkjtUCv6ppm1gUAR2MretT
  • 64c651248a7a0410f1ff52f1a784fa1a06a03d83faa2c669d63ae2c4bb851b59:1
  • value  1097750
    address  12xeEcbjtegwSBXpLni7Yoe6CTdsEW4kFZ